Choose the right LTA or AT for your applications and experience greater flexibility with your operations.

(Choose the power required first, the power will determine the flow available at the intended temperature)

Next decide on an Airtorch model from the available LTA, AT and Ultra Plasma models.

Airtorch™ Applications 1

Aluminum Brazing
Scorching/Burn off/Curing
The Airtorch™ has opened up new possibilities in brazing and joining technologies. Whereas in the past brazing furnaces were cumbersome and expensive, Airtorch™ allows for inexpensive processes.
aluminum brazing
The Airtorch™ can be used for curing, surface burning and sealing operations. The possibilities are endless as Air, Nitrogen, Helium and Argon can be used.
scorching/burn off/curing
Large Die Heating
Direct Ceramic Drying
The Airtorch™ allows large die heat-up; reclaim dies and aluminum.


large die heating
Free and bonded water can be easily removed. The Airtorch™ can achieve very high temperatures without contamination, therefore direct drying is a natural application. MHI also manufactures several Airtorch™ Continuous ovens.
direct ceramic drying
Binder Burn Off
Heating for Tensile Testing
Easy, uniform, safe, and collectable binder burn off. For ceramics, nitrides, powder metals, etc. Substantially improve quality and productivity.
binder burn off
When high temperatures are needed in spaces where resistance heating elements cannot be used, the Airtorch™ provides the solution.

heating for tensile testing
Packaging or Sealing
Die Heating
Designed for long life and high temperatures, the non-contaminating Airtorch™ is an ideal solution for inline packaging or sealing processes.
packaging or sealing
Use the Airtorch™ as a preheating device for dies in the metal forging and rolling industries.
die heating
Soldering, Melting and Dental

Use the Airtorch™ for softening, soldering, and melting of precious metals and glass. This feature is very applicable to the dental, jewelry, and glass industries. Use for rapid glazing, burnout and quick melts.
